Places To Help Find A Job

There are many employment centers and services that can help you with your job search. These are some of them:

YOUTHSOURCE CENTER These centers work with teens from 14-24, living in Los Angeles. They provide help with your job search, job skill training, tutoring and college mentoring.

REGIONAL OCCUPATIONAL PROGRAM or 1- (562) 922-6850  Many school districts have ROP’s located in local high schools. A ROP can help you learn a job skill, get work experience and on-the-job training, earn high school credits, and prepare for career training.

WorkSource or 1- (888) 226-6300  Work Source centers are for youth over age 21.  They provide job skills assessments, technology training, and information about what jobs are out there.

Job Corps or 1- (213) 748-0134  This program instructs young people with informaton about careers, and how to find and keep a job.

Los Angeles Conservation Corps  This program privides job training and jobs with an emphasis on conservation and service projects that benefit the community.

SUMMER JOBS

Most of the centers above will have information on summer jobs. There are also summer jobs available specifically for foster youth ages 16-21 through a program called Bridges to Work.

RESOURCES FOR FORMER FOSTER YOUTH

The Right Way Foundation (RWF) or 213-746-6821.
A one-stop shop for career counseling, academic counseling, and entrepreneurship support.

Youth Career Development Program (YCDP). YCDP is a 12 to 24-month paid internship program that provides both work experience and academic training. The goal of the program is to prepare youth for a full-time, permanent position as a County employee. Contact YCDP at 1 – (562) 940-2999 for more information.
